Grant Thornton International Ltd (GTIL) is one of the world's leading networks of independent audit and tax advisory firms. Founded in 1980 (with historical roots dating back to 1924) and headquartered in London, the organization coordinates a global network active in over 150 countries. The service portfolio includes Audit & Assurance (including financial statement audits), comprehensive tax advisory (Tax Services), Advisory Services, Business Process Solutions, and legal advisory (Legal Services). With a strong focus on mid-sized businesses as well as capital market-oriented companies and public institutions, Grant Thornton offers tailored, collaborative advisory services. The network combines global reach with deep local market knowledge to reliably support clients with growth, transformation, and compliance issues. Overall, client and employee reviews for Grant Thornton show a solid but mixed picture: many highlight the good working atmosphere, strong team cohesion, and flexible working models (e.g., home office, flexible office), but some criticize high workloads, organizational issues, and inconsistent leadership culture depending on the location or team. Strengths clearly lie in culture, collegiality, and modern, flexible work design, while workload, compensation relative to workload, leadership quality, and development transparency are mentioned as weaknesses. Grant Thornton is particularly suitable for specialists and managers in the audit, tax, and advisory sectors who value an international environment with good team cohesion and flexibility and are willing to accept periods of high work intensity, especially during peak phases.
